Players take out time to visit Spastic Society In Bangalore

A glimpse of the team with the children
Taking a break from the daily hockey training, several members of our senior national hockey team visited the Spastic Society of Karnataka’s unit in Bangalore on 16th December 2011.
Away from the hectic training and preparatory schedule ahead of the Olympic Qualification tournament in 2012, players along with Chief Coach Michael Nobbs managed some time to meet the kids suffering from Neuro-­‐Muscular and Developmental Disabilities. Coach and Captain Bharat Chetri along with a dozen of players spent almost 2 hours with these kids in their coaching and art centres.
The Spastics Society of Karnataka is a Non‐Government Organization(NGO) dedicated to the welfare of persons with Neuro-­‐Muscular and Developmental Disabilities. The society provides a Comprehensive Package of Diagnostic and Intervention services to persons with Cerebral Palsy, Autism, Mental Retardation, Multiple Disabilities and Learning Disabilities.
